About the Team

The Procurement team at College Board is a group of 10 highly skilled professionals who support the purchasing needs of all divisions across the organization. Our category coverage is extensive and encompasses a wide range of areas such as contingent workforce, conferences, and events, building and construction projects, enterprise software systems, contact centers, custom consulting engagements, and cloud services. The category managers work directly with leaders from all parts of the business to help define and deliver College Board products and services. College Board is transforming its business at a rapid pace and the procurement team plays a crucial role in shaping and driving this change.

About the Opportunity

As our Category Manager - Travel, you will execute the strategic sourcing, vendor relationship, and contract management activities for the Advanced Placement (AP) program's national events (e.g. reader gathering). You will implement innovative sourcing strategies, engage in comprehensive industry and supplier research, and manage the bidding and RFP process. You will oversee site and vendor selection, lead contract negotiations and supplier performance management activities to secure competitive process and favorable terms. You will collaborate closely with College Board Program and Service units to competitively source products and services that align with both mission and financial objectives. Your strategic and proactive mindset and operational excellence will be key driver of success in this role.

In this role, you will:

Collaborate with business partners to drive value (40%)

  • Work within the procurement organization to provide dedicated support to the AP program specifically focused on large event site management

  • Partner with business unit stakeholders to select vendors and determine work streams where price competition would be beneficial and coordinate RFI’s, RFP’s and RFQ’s

  • Bring industry benchmarks, expertise, knowledge of trends, consultant, and other third-party data to bear in preparation for vendor selection and negotiation

Execute agreements and manage vendors (40%)

  • Lead vendor negotiations to ensure that College Board contracts at competitive prices and favorable terms with an emphasis on convention centers, hotels, and catering

  • Coordinate with legal, governance, risk & compliance and College Board business units for contract review and negotiation

  • Anticipate and manage possible contingencies and dependencies, ensuring proactive planning and real-time analytical thinking during intense periods of delivery

  • Own and manage key vendor relationships for appropriate issue escalation Work with vendors to resolve performance and to bring about improvements where needed

Improve our support and performance (20%)

  • Utilize P2P tools like Workday, Concur and Strategic Sourcing to establish and help improve operational processes from project intake to invoice approvals

  • Practice continual improvement to strengthen the value proposition for internal clients and improve key performance as measured by KPIs that are important to key constituents

  • Contribute to analyzing AP Reading expenses to identify and generate cost savings

  • Absorb previously outsourced work, ensuring a seamless transition, and subsequently optimizing processes to generate cost savings

About You

You have:

  • 7+ years of procurement related experience and expertise in evaluating contractual terms and conditions

  • Strong industry experience negotiating and contracting with convention centers, hotels, airlines, catering, travel management companies and other vendor types necessary for large scale meetings and conferences

  • Superior quantitative and qualitative analytical skills

  • Proven track record of negotiating large multi-year contracts and negotiating with various vendors essential for large-scale events

  • Excellent interpersonal skills and the ability to foster positive working relationships at all organizational levels.

  • Initiative and an ability to work in a self-directed environment

  • Experience with contract management, P2P systems, and tools

  • A bachelor's degree in business, management, finance, supply chain management or related work experience preferred

  • Proficient with Microsoft Office (MS Word, Excel, Access, PowerPoint)

  • Ability to travel 4-6 times a year

  • You must be authorized to work in the US

College Board is a mission-driven not-for-profit organization that connects students to college success and opportunity. Founded in 1900, College Board was created to expand access to higher education. Today, the membership association is made up of over 6,000 of the world’s leading educational institutions and is dedicated to promoting excellence and equity in education. Each year, College Board helps more than seven million students prepare for a successful transition to college through programs and services in college readiness and college success—including the SAT, the Advanced Placement Program, and BigFuture. The organization also serves the education community through research and advocacy on behalf of students, educators, and schools.

Paid Time Off & Holidays

Employees enjoy major holidays off, an additional week off for New Year's Day, plus 20 PTO days and 10 sick days annually.

8 Weeks Paid Parental Leave

College Board provides 8 weeks of paid leave for all parents, including adoptive, biological, and foster, supporting family growth and bonding.

Pet Insurance Options

Understanding that pets are family too, College Board offers pet insurance policies to help cover both routine care and unexpected illnesses or injuries.

Generous Retirement Match

After six months, College Board contributes double to the TIAA retirement plan, up to 10% of an employee's annual salary, fostering a robust retirement savings.
